Geometry snapshot
| Spec | Ducati Scrambler Urban Motard | SWM Gran Turismo 440 |
|---|---|---|
| Seat height | 805 mm | 808 mm |
| Wheelbase | 1,436 mm | 1,440 mm |
| Wet weight | 196 kg | 168 kg |
| Displacement | 803 cc | 445 cc |
